Key Components of a Successful Digital Loyalty Strategy
- Data-Centric Personalization: Using analytics to tailor offerings, communicate at optimum times, and anticipate customer needs.
- Gamification & Reward Mechanics: Incorporating badges, tiers, and challenges that foster ongoing participation.
- Responsible Gaming Integration: Embedding features such as self-exclusion options, spending controls, and real-time feedback to promote responsible behavior.
- Transparency & Trust: Clear communication of reward structures and data privacy policies to reinforce consumer confidence.
